VANTAGENS E DESVANTAGENS DOS ALGORITMOS DE CLASSIFICAÇÃO | Curso Machine Learning com Python #55

Introdução

Olá a todos e bem-vindos a um novo vídeo do meu canal. Neste vídeo, vou falar sobre as vantagens e desvantagens dos algoritmos de classificação. Embora um algoritmo nem sempre seja melhor que outro, existem algumas propriedades de cada algoritmo que devemos usar como guias para selecionar o correto de forma rápida e para ajustar os parâmetros operacionais. A direção correta do algoritmo muitas vezes permanece pouco clara, a menos que testemos diretamente nossos algoritmos por meio de tentativa e erro. Neste vídeo, você verá alguns algoritmos de machine learning para problemas de classificação e poderá estabelecer diretrizes para quando usá-los com base em suas fortalezas e fraquezas.

Regressão Logística

Definição: A regressão logística é apropriada para realizar análise de regressão quando a variável dependente é binária. É um análise preditivo utilizado para descrever dados e explicar a relação entre uma variável binária dependente e uma ou mais variáveis independentes nominais ordinárias ou de nível de razão.

Vantagens: Fácil de entender e explicar, uso de regularização é efetivo na seleção de funções, rápido e fácil de treinar sobre grandes conjuntos de dados.

Desvantagens: Tendência ao sobreajuste, pode sofrer com valores atípicos, pode ser simples demais para aceitar relações complexas entre variáveis.

Modelagem de respostas de marketing, previsão de votos, etc.

Vizinhos Mais Próximos

Definição: Algoritmo de machine learning simples, versátil, baseado na similaridade de características, não faz suposições sobre a distribuição dos dados.

Vantagens: Treinamento rápido, pode lidar com problemas de multi classes, útil para detecção de intrusos e sistemas de recomendação.

Desvantagens: Lento para prever novas instâncias, necessidade de definir uma função de distância significativa, não ideal para dados de alta dimensionalidade.

Segurança informática, detecção de intrusos, sistemas de recomendação, etc.

Máquinas Vectores de Suporte

Definição: Baseia-se na construção de um hiperplano ótimo para separar duas classes em um conjunto de dados.

Vantagens: Pode modelar relações não lineares complexas, robusto ao ruído.

Desvantagens: Necessidade de selecionar uma boa função de kernel, parâmetros difíceis de interpretar, memória e poder de processamento significativos.

Classificação de texto, imagens, etc.

Clasificador Naïve Bayes

Definição: Modelo probabilístico baseado no teorema de Bayes.

Vantagens: Fácil e rápido de implementar, pode ser usado para aprendizado em linha, fácil de entender.

Desvantagens: Falha ao estimar características raras, pode sofrer com características irrelevantes.

Reconhecimento de rostos, análise de sentimentos, detecção de spam, etc.

Árvores de Decisão

Definição: Diagramas de construção lógica para categorizar condições sucessivas.

Vantagens: Fácil de interpretar, rápido, preciso, excelente para aprender relações complexas.

Desvantagens: Valores complexos são difíceis de interpretar, possibilidade de duplicação dentro do mesmo sub-árvore.

Diagnóstico médico, análise de risco creditício, etc.

Espero que essas informações sejam úteis para o desenvolvimento dos seus projetos de machine learning. Obrigado por assistir e nos vemos no próximo vídeo! Até mais!

As vantagens e desvantagens dos algoritmos de classificação em Machine Learning

Nos últimos anos, o Machine Learning tem se tornado uma ferramenta poderosa para análise de dados e tomada de decisões em diversas áreas. Com o aumento da quantidade de dados disponíveis, os algoritmos de classificação se tornaram essenciais para identificar padrões e fazer previsões com base nessas informações. Neste artigo, abordaremos as vantagens e desvantagens dos algoritmos de classificação em Machine Learning.

Vantagens dos algoritmos de classificação

Os algoritmos de classificação oferecem diversas vantagens que contribuem para a eficácia do Machine Learning em diferentes cenários. Algumas das principais vantagens incluem:

Identificação de padrões complexos

Os algoritmos de classificação conseguem identificar padrões complexos nos dados, o que pode ser difícil de ser feito manualmente. Isso permite prever com precisão o comportamento futuro com base nos dados históricos.

Tomada de decisões automatizada

Com os algoritmos de classificação, é possível automatizar a tomada de decisões com base em critérios pré-definidos. Isso agiliza o processo de análise de dados e permite uma resposta mais rápida às mudanças no ambiente.

Escalabilidade

Os algoritmos de classificação são facilmente escaláveis para lidar com grandes volumes de dados. Isso os torna ideais para empresas que lidam com uma quantidade crescente de informações e precisam de soluções eficientes para a análise desses dados.

Desvantagens dos algoritmos de classificação

Apesar das vantagens, os algoritmos de classificação também apresentam algumas desvantagens que precisam ser consideradas ao utilizar essa abordagem em Machine Learning. Algumas das principais desvantagens incluem:

Overfitting

O overfitting é um problema comum em algoritmos de classificação, onde o modelo se ajusta demais aos dados de treinamento e acaba tendo baixa capacidade de generalização para novos dados. Isso pode levar a previsões imprecisas e resultados não confiáveis.

Requerimento de dados de qualidade

Os algoritmos de classificação dependem de dados de qualidade para produzir resultados precisos. Caso os dados estejam incompletos, incorretos ou desbalanceados, o desempenho do modelo pode ser comprometido.

Interpretabilidade

Alguns algoritmos de classificação, como redes neurais e árvores de decisão, podem ser difíceis de interpretar, tornando difícil compreender como o modelo chegou a determinada previsão. Isso pode limitar a confiança nos resultados gerados pelos algoritmos.

Compreender as vantagens e desvantagens dos algoritmos de classificação em Machine Learning é essencial para utilizar essa técnica de forma eficaz e obter resultados precisos. Ao considerar esses aspectos, é possível maximizar o potencial dos algoritmos de classificação e tomar decisões informadas com base nas previsões geradas por esses modelos.

Vantagens e Desvantagens dos Algoritmos de Classificação

Uma das principais vantagens dos algoritmos de classificação no marketing digital é a capacidade de segmentar o público-alvo com precisão, permitindo campanhas mais eficazes e personalizadas. Além disso, esses algoritmos podem ajudar a identificar padrões e tendências no comportamento dos consumidores, o que é essencial para a tomada de decisões estratégicas.

No entanto, é importante ressaltar que os algoritmos de classificação também apresentam algumas desvantagens. Por exemplo, eles podem ser influenciados por viéses e preconceitos presentes nos dados de treinamento, o que pode resultar em decisões erradas e injustas. Além disso, a complexidade desses algoritmos pode dificultar a interpretação dos resultados, tornando mais desafiador o ajuste e otimização dos modelos.

Em suma, os algoritmos de classificação são ferramentas poderosas no marketing digital, mas é fundamental estar ciente das suas vantagens e desvantagens para utilizá-los de forma eficaz. Com um planejamento adequado e análise constante dos resultados, é possível aproveitar ao máximo o potencial desses algoritmos para otimizar as estratégias de marketing e alcançar melhores resultados.

Conclusão sobre Vantagens e Desvantagens dos Algoritmos de Classificação no Marketing Digital

Fonte Consultada: Texto gerado a partir do Vídeo https://www.youtube.com/watch?v=T8aCfSBlrqU do Canal AprendeIA con Ligdi Gonzalez .

Rolar para cima